The full bench of the Supreme Court will hold a hearing in August to deliberate on two cases regarding conscientious objectors. For the first time in 14 years, the full bench will decide whether or not such conscientious objectors should be subject to criminal punishment. In 2004, the full bench ruled that those who refuse mandatory military service based on their religious beliefs should face criminal punishment. The Supreme Court said on Monday that it referred the two cases to the courtÂ’s 12- member bench and a hearing will be held on August 30th. On 12 June 2018 in saratov and in the region, law enforcement officials conducted mass records in the homes of citizens suspected of having the religion of Jehovah's witnesses. Three were arrested and sent to jail: Konstantin Bazhenov, 43-Year-Old Alexei Budenchuk, 35, and felix makhammadiev, 33. At least 7 searches are known in the city of saratov and with. Broad (region). Acting extremely rudely, law enforcement officials hacked the doors of the apartments.
